C. Provide Cast Iron Detectable/Tactile Warning Surface Indicator Plates which are in compliance with the following standards (or most recent): 1. Americans with Disabilities Act (Title III Regulations, 28 CFR Part 36 ADA STANDARDS FOR ACCESSIBLE DESIGN, Appendix A, Section 4.29.2 DETECTABLE WARNINGS ON WALKING SURFACES). D. Gray Cast Iron Detectable/Tactile Warning Surface Indicator Plates shall be according to ASTM A 48M, Class 35B, and shall be bare and not coated with paint or other coatings or substances. Castings shall be sound, free from pouring faults, cracks, blowholes, and other defects. E. Dimensions: The plate shall incorporate an in-line pattern of truncated domes measuring nominal 0.2” height, 0.90” base diameter, 0.45” top diameter spaced center-to-center 2.35” (+/- 0.05) For wheelchair safety the field area shall consist of a series of micro texture 0.06” high. F. Product Data: Cast Iron Detectable/Tactile Warning Surface Indicator Plates shall meet or exceed the following test criteria: ASTM A 327 Impact Resistance No damage @ 54 J ASTM A 48 Standard Specification for Gray Iron Castings ASTM D695 Compressive Strength 114,000 psi ASTM D638 Tensile Strength 35,000 psi ASTM C 501 Abrasive Wear Index ≥ 8800 1.5 DELIVERY, STORAGE AND HANDLING A. The physical characteristics of the concrete shall be consistent with the contract specifications while maintaining a slump range of 3-4 inches to permit solid placement of the Cast Iron Detectable/Tactile Warning Surface Indicator Plates. E. When preparing to set the plate, ensure that the area to receive the plates has been finished to its final elevation. The concrete shall be poured and finished true and smooth to the required dimensions and slope prior to the plate placement. Vents in the plate allow air and displaced concrete to escape during the installation process. F. Lift the Detectable/Tactile Warning Surface Indicator plate and gently place into position onto the wet concrete. The plate shall be placed true and square to the curb edge in accordance with the contract drawings. Press into the concrete. The Cast Iron Detectable/Tactile Warning Surface Indicator Plates shall be tamped into the fresh concrete to ensure that the field level of the plate is flush to the adjacent concrete surface. G. Immediately after placement, the plate elevation is to be checked to adjacent concrete, and the concrete around the perimeter of the tile should be finished. The elevation and slope should be set consistent with contract drawings to permit water drainage to curb as the design dictates. Ensure that the field surface of the plate is flush with the surrounding concrete and back of curb so that no ponding is possible on the plate at the back side of curb, and to eliminate tripping hazards between adjacent finishes. Dennis Yarmouth Intermediate Middle School January 19, 2021 Dennis Yarmouth Regional School District 100% Construction Documents Perkins Eastman DPC, project #71011 32 1726 Tactile Warning Surfaces 5 of 5 H. While concrete is workable, create a 1/4” concrete-free recess around the perimeter of the plate. Use a 3/8” radius edging tool to create a finished edge of concrete, then a steel trowel shall be used to finish the concrete around the plate’s perimeter, flush to the field level of the plate. I. Clean the surface of the tile of any concrete that has protruded from the vent holes. J. During and after the Detectable/Tactile Warning Surface Indicator Plate installation and the concrete curing stage, it is imperative that there is no walking, leaning or external force placed on the plate that may rock the plate causing a void between the underside of Detectable/Tactile Warning Surface Indicator Plate and concrete. K. Following Detectable/Tactile Warning Surface Indicator Plate placement, review installation tolerances to contract drawings and adjust plate before the concrete sets. L. Following the concrete curing stage, a soft brass wire brush will clean the residue without damage to the plate surface. 3.2 PROTECTION AND MAINTENANCE A.
